Other mistake: In 1902 at the German cafe, Kaunitz spits in Clive's face, and Clive promptly hits him, causing Kaunitz to fall down the steps. After this, several German students close behind Clive are wearing decorative ribbons to show their affiliations. The problem is the costuming department has used ribbons intended to mount miniature British medals for the 1914 or 1914-15 Star, British War Medal and Victory. These decorations didn't exist until 1918/1919 at the earliest. (00:36:01 - 00:38:01)

Other mistake: In the windmill scene, the windmill reverses directions twice to signal the airplane. However when Joel McRae enters the windmill and we see the machinery it is obvious that there is no mechanism to reverse the windmill against the wind.
